La Fornace Penna è un monumento di archeologia industriale e si trova in contrada Pisciotto a Sampieri, frazione del comune di Scicli in provincia di Ragusa. La Fornace Penna fu realizzata tra il 1909 ed il 1912 su progetto dell'ingegnere Ignazio Emmolo, che si laureò in matematica a Catania e in ingegneria civile a Napoli nel 1895. Creando la società con l'appoggio del barone Guglielmo Penna, scelse il sito di "Punta Pisciotto" a ridosso del mare, per i seguenti motivi: il fondale sufficientemente profondo da consentire l'attracco delle navi[1], la presenza della ferrovia, la vicina cava di argilla, a circa 200 metri, per la materia prima, la disponibilità di abbondante acqua da una sorgente carsica locale. Lo stabilimento produceva laterizi che venivano esportati in molti paesi mediterranei: gran parte di Tripoli (Libia) dopo la guerra del 1911 fu costruita con laterizi del "Pisciotto" . Si lavorava dalla sei del mattino sino all'imbrunire, da maggio a settembre; con le prime piogge la Fornace Penna veniva chiusa. Vi hanno trovato occupazione un centinaio di operai in età compresa tra i 16 e i 18 anni. La cessazione dell'attività dello stabilimento avvenne durante la notte del 26 gennaio 1924, a causa di un incendio doloso che lo distrusse in poche ore.
